The lonliest people
push away arms that care
they kick at gifts of comfort
as if the lonliness itself were a grey woollen blanket
wrapped tight around themselves
protection against feeling anything at all
except lonliness
because that would make the blanket fall
and leave them cold
naked in the light
and vulnerable
to vicious attacks of kindness
